目录
5、Linux项目自动化构建工具——make/Makefile
1、Linux软件包管理器——yum
(1)软件包管理工具:安装其他软件工具
yum是Linux下非常常用的一种包管理器,主要应用在Fedora,RedHat,Centos等发行版上,类似于手机上的应用商店,提供软件包安装、查看、移除等操作
(2)查看软件包:yum list——查看所有软件包;yum search——搜索指定软件包
(3)安装软件包:yum install
注意:安装软件时一般需要sudo或者切换到root账户下完成;yum安装软件只能一个装完了再装另一个(sudo配置:临时为用户操作提权需配置后才能使用)
(4)将软件包保存到本地:yum makecache
(5)卸载软件包:yum remove
2、Linux编辑器——vim
编辑器:写代码
(1)vim的基本概念
vim有三种模式:普通模式、插入模式和底行模式
a.正常/普通/命令模式:控制屏幕光标的移动,字符、字或行的删除,移动复制某区段进入插入模式或底行模式
b.插入模式:文字输入,按Esc回到普通模式
c.底行模式:文件保存或退出,也可以进行文件替换,找字符串、列出行号等操作
(2)vim的基本操作(vim filename:打开文件)
a.普通模式切换至插入模式:输入i/a/o/I/A/O
b.插入模式切换至普通模式:按Esc
c.正常模式切换至底行模式:按Shift+;
d.底行模式下,保存当前文件(:w);保存并退出(:wq);不保存强制退出(:q)
(3)vim普通模式命令集
a.插入模式
按 i 进入插入模式后是从光标当前位置开始输入文件
按 a 进入插入模式后是从目前光标所在位置的下一个位置开始输入文字
按 o 进入插入模式后是插入新的一行,从行首开始输入文字
b.移动光标
vim使用小写字母 h、j、k、l分别控制光标左、下、上、右移一格
按 G 移动到文章的最后
按 $ 移动到光标所在行的行尾
按 ^ 移动到光标行所在的行首
按 w 光标跳到下个字的开头
按 e 光标跳到下个字的字尾
按 b 光标回到上个字的开头
按 gg进入到文本开始
按 shift+g 进入文本末端
按Ctrl+b / Ctrl+f 屏幕往后